The Forgotten
We both really enjoyed this movie. I have since heard it panned and negative things said about it - but we liked it alot. Julianne Moore (The Hours) stars, and I think she looks and moves great for a 43 year old woman ;) The premise is fascinating - she has a son and husband and a life, and then one by one they begin to disappear. The child is dead, the husband doesn't know her - it's eerie and frankly fascinating to watch.
There are 2 different scenes that made us and the whole theater JUMP. It's so rare for that to happen in a movie that it made this a stand out for us. The story takes a few strange turns but throughout it's interesting and keeps you glued to it to find out what is happening.
One of my favorite actresses is in this movie - Alfre Woodard (Radio) and I loved every minute that she's on screen. She's a detective and she puts a nice spin on that role - she has some very good lines too.
This one got a 4. Definitely original and caught us by surprise so it gets extra points for that. :)
